Founded in 1967, the Revue Française de Pédagogie represents a leading location for scientific discussion and publication of education research in the French-speaking world. It addresses issues with a broad perspective that is open to diverse approaches and to contributions from multiple disciplines, including psychology, sociology, philosophy, history, and education. Generally grouped into themed collections, the papers provide access to the most recent contributions to education research. Each issue also includes an executive summary, which presents and critiques gains, changes, and topical issues in research on a given area, broadening horizons on a national and international level. Finally, the column "Critical Reviews" provides readers information and reflection on the most important recent publications.

• ISSN : 05567807
• 4 issues per year

Hommage à Viviane Isambert-Jamati
Homage to Viviane Isambert-Jamati
This issue of the Revue française de pédagogie is entirely dedicated to the work of Viviane Isambert-Jamati, who died on November 19, 2019. After a presentation that underlines the originality and fruitfulness of her work, this report brings together nine of her texts published between 1973 and 2005, and which have become difficult to access.

La LPPR et la réforme de l'enseignement supérieur et de la recherche : analyses critiques
The LPPR and the reform of higher education and research in France: critical analyses
Reflecting opposition to the Multi-Year Research Programming (LPPR) law in France, the RFP brings together in this issue contributions from specialists in higher education and research from varied backgrounds; By setting up a dialogue between these different points of view, the journal sets out to make a critical contributition to debate.

Quand étudier, c'est travailler. Cadres institués des études et perspectives étudiantes
When studying is working. Established frameworks and student perspectives
This issue focuses on the question of learning in higher education by using methods and concepts from the sociology of work. This heuristic perspective seeks to make visible all the activities and dimensions of student work. This approach focuses on their practices, their own rationales, which may or may not lead to success.
